While CJ Stroud is looking a lot better right now, Carolina fans can't give up hope. Lots of QBs looked like garbage at first. Elway, Peyton, Josh Allen...
 
While CJ Stroud is looking a lot better right now, Carolina fans can't give up hope.
CJ went into a better situtation overall. I believe Young would be enjoying a better season if he had been drafted by the Texans. Right now, he's trying to be Superman and forcing throws. CJ has the luxury of trusting his WR to get open. If you watch the 3 games where Stroud struggled, the D had his receivers blanketed.

I blame the Carolina brass. They traded away the best WR on the team. Yeah, the Panthers picked a WR in the 2nd round, but Mingo hasn't lived up to the 2nd round billing. Other than Thielen, he doesn't have any real targets.
Lots of QBs looked like garbage at first. Elway, Peyton, Josh Allen...
Troy Aikman went 0-11 as a rookie. He went on to win 3 Superbowls. I credit Jimmy Johnson for built a solid team around him by acquiring draft capital--including 18 picks😲 in 1991.

The Panthers don't have many pieces or much draft capital. It's going to be a long couple of years before we can see Young live up to his potential.
